Yesterday I showed you how to make a Starburst Card.  Today I want to show you a variation on that same card!

We made these cards in my Dream Pop card workshop.  Basically, the starburst starts along the left edge of the card base, instead of in the center. 

 Here are the steps:
*Cut 1.5" x 5.5" strips of patterned paper (double sided is best).
*Take strip and turn it in your cutter so that it's diagonal.  Line up opposite corners along your cut line and CUT.  Now you have 2 diagonal strips



*Starting at the left side of the card, line up a straight edge along the fold of the card.

 *Fan out the rest of your pieces, making sure to cover the top and side of your card- no white spaces.  Also make sure to cover your line at the bottom. 

*Adhere your bottom piece, embellish and voila!  
**This card uses the embossed cardstock from Dream pop, Cricut Artiste shape, A True Thank You stamp set- colored in Cotton Candy, Lagoon & Creme Brule markers, black shimmer trim and bling buttons.
